A Florida man has been arrested for allegedly shooting at an Israeli father and son, claiming he believed they were Palestinian. The unprovoked attack occurred Saturday night on Pine Tree Drive, leaving the victims injured but thankfully alive.  

According to the arrest report, 27-year-old Mordechai Brafman of Miami was captured on surveillance video driving erratically before stopping his truck directly in front of the victim’s vehicle. Brafman then exited his truck and fired 17 shots at the passing car, striking the driver in the shoulder and grazing his son’s arm.

Police apprehended Brafman shortly after the incident. During his arrest, he reportedly stated that he had “seen two Palestinians and shot and killed both.” However, the victims, Ari Revay and his father, confirmed to Local 10 News that they are Israeli.  

“It was a truck passing next to (us),” Ari Revay recounted in Hebrew. “‘Boom, boom, boom’ and he randomly started shooting. He put the window down, driver’s seat and just blasted (us).”

Revay’s father, who was driving, narrowly escaped serious injury as a bullet passed close to his ear. “God, life is a gift,” said Ari Revay, expressing gratitude for their survival.

Brafman is facing two charges of attempted second-degree murder. The motive behind the shooting remains unclear, but Brafman’s alleged statement suggests a possible hate crime.
